Ross Cameron Stewart (born 11 July 1996) is a Scottish professional footballer who plays as a forward for EFL Championship club Southampton and the Scotland national team. He will become a free agent on 30 June 2026. He began his career with Ardeer Thistle and Kilwinning Rangers before joining Albion Rovers in 2016. After one season, Stewart moved to St Mirren and went on loan to Alloa Athletic. In 2018, he joined Ross County, spending three seasons with the club before joining Sunderland in 2021 and helping them win promotion to the Championship. Stewart then signed for Southampton in 2023.
